terry its a solid kit I had a good time doing mine OS 120 pumped engine full house retracts including tail wheel here is another thread that I contributed to as well http://www.rcuniverse.com/forum/m_48...tm.htm#4868696 lots of good input.

I mounted the gear in the stock locations and there fine where there at.

my one suggestion would be think about using 3/32 sheeting for the wings instead of the supplied 1/16 sheeting, I had some warping that I did correct with filler but if I was to build another one,I would go with the slightly thicker wood for the wing sheeting, otherwise it was a easy to build model that looks great.

mine is now in the hangar getting a upgraded OS120 Surpass III pumped engine and a new 2.4 receiver
